About the Customer
Whitworths is passionate about bringing the very best that nature has to offer and has been providing dried fruits, nuts and seeds for baking and snacking since 1886. Whitworths provide an extensive range of conveniently prepared dried fruits and nuts for baking. They also provide high quality snacking products, either in a multi-serve or on-the-go format, which includes the Shots and Fusions range.
The Challenge
As a supplier to UK supermarkets including Tesco, Sainsbury’s, Asda, Lidl and Budgens, Whitworths had been exchanging orders and invoices via EDI for many years. Historically, Whitworths had relied on an on premise EDI solution that was managed by the company’s IT department, however when the company upgraded to a new ERP system it became apparent that a new approach to EDI was required.
Integrating its incumbent EDI solution with its new IFS ERP system would have been hugely costly and would have required considerable internal IT resource which was not readily available, therefore Whitworths made the decision to outsource its EDI requirements.
“After embarking on an ERP upgrade project it became clear that we needed to change EDI providers. We were looking for a solution that would enable us to react quickly and cost effectively to changes such as a new ERP system or additional customer connections.” said Steven Griffiths, Head of IT at Whitworths. “We subsequently decided that the time was right to move to an outsourced solution and were impressed with TrueCommerce’s offering and customer references.”
The Solution
Whitworths made the decision to outsource its EDI requirements to TrueCommerce for an outsourced, fully managed solution that could be integrated with its new IFS back office system.
TrueCommerce’s dedicated and highly skilled team of implementation and on-boarding specialists managed the entire implementation and on-boarding process for Whitworths which included defining the requirements, configuration, testing and progress reporting.
Once the implementation process was completed, a handover was made to TrueCommerce’s dedicated managed service team, who look after the day-to-day running of EDI on Whitworth’s behalf.

Detailed Results & Business Impact
More Supported
TrueCommerce’s managed service team have removed the day-to-day responsibility of maintaining an EDI solution from Whitworths, pro-actively monitoring the platform for message validation errors. The managed service team are intimately familiar with individual client implementations and are therefore able to resolve issues rapidly.
“Due to an oversight on our part EDI invoicing was not fully tested during the migration to a new ERP system, as a consequence EDI formats were not correctly setup and were therefore being rejected by our customers. Obviously this severely affected our cash flow and we needed a very quick resolution. TrueCommerce immediately setup a project team to handle the issue and, adhering to an agreed action plan, worked very closely with our customers to agree new invoice formats and push them through from testing to live.” said Steven Griffiths, Head of IT at Whitworths. “If we had undertaken this project on our own we would not have achieved the results we did as quickly, if at all. It was the fact that TrueCommerce had excellent experience of undertaking this type of work and very good contacts in the multiples that won the day.”
Whitworths now benefit from a stable and reliable EDI platform that enables them to meet the electronic trading requirements of its customers, whilst streamlining their internal processes. As a fully scalable service, the company are able to quickly and easily add new trading partners to the platform without tying up internal teams, something which is key to Whitworths as it continues to expand.
